Outlook 2007

Is there some way to zoom down the Reading Pane? I would like to display it at 50%. Not change the
size of the Reading Pane but reduce the size of the contents. Is that doable?

Hi Stewart,

If I understand your problem correctly we can reduce the zoom on outlook
reading pane by holding the control key and use the mouse wheel.
Scroll the mouse wheel to change the zoom. Usually by scrolling the
mouse wheel backwards decreases the zoom.

I want to permanently change the zoom -- and for the entire Reading Pane. Using the mouse wheel
only reduces one section at a time. You need to do the heading separately and you need to do it
every time you open a message.

Isn't there a way to just adjust the zoom for the Reading Pane once and keep it adjusted?

For some formats (HTML and Rich Text) of messages, you can use the scroll
wheel while holding Ctrl in the Reading Pane to change the zoom.
